Erie Insurance Group, headquartered in the city's Central Business District, became Erie County's largest employer in 2018 with more than 2,800 local employees, and it owns the naming rights to the Erie Insurance Arena downtown. Manufacturing retains a foothold through Wabtec's locomotive plant, alongside smaller-scale steel and plastics producers that replaced the city's heavier industrial past. Health care is a major sector as well, led by UPMC Hamot and Saint Vincent Health System.
Downtown Erie splits into three areas: Bayfront Landing, center city, and midtown, with roughly 20,000 people working across the 70-block district that runs from State Street to 14th Street. Tourism adds another layer to the economy, with Presque Isle State Park drawing more than four million visitors a year and Pennsylvania's sales-tax exemption on clothing pulling shoppers from Ohio, New York, and Ontario to the Millcreek Mall corridor.
